Moonlight Sky
As the stars serenades the moon that has faintly lit the night sky As I sit here in amazement at God’s creation and never question why As I look up at the sky and all the beauty so far up above I am now at peace to feel God's everlasting love Let me show you stars that shine so bright How they sparkle and twinkle at the light It's like I'm in a state of trance My soul just feels free and wants to dance If I was a bird spreading my wings to fly Every day I would purposely soar so high This is where the boundaries disappear Beneath the night sky our stories become quite clear Through the vivid light of the lonely moon The break of dawn is coming and the sun will arise soon As the vividness fades from the stars array The night journeys on into endless day
